F1: Crawford to drive FP1 at Suzuka

Jak Crawford will take part in Free Practice 1 at the Japanese Grand Prix, taking over Fernando Alonso's AMR26. The session will mark his first FP1 appearance as the team's third driver, giving him the opportunity to further integrate with the team during a race weekend. It also fulfils one of the team's mandated rookie sessions this season. His extensive simulator work has been a key part of his role, which will be particularly valuable at Suzuka, a circuit he has never driven at before. The FP1 session will provide important real-world experience at one of Formula One's most iconic and challenging tracks.
